Home > United Kingdom > Wales > West Glamorgan > Mumbles
Prezzo - Mumbles
Italian Restaurant
Unit 2 Oyster Wharf, Mumbles, West Glamorgan, SA3 4DN
01792 686372
moreServing irresistible Italian cuisine in casual, friendly ..
Restaurants and Food ShoppingItalian Restaurants |